Sternberg
Refers to Robert Sternberg, a psychologist known for his theory on the triarchic theory of intelligence which includes analytical, creative, and practical components.
Practical Intelligence
The ability to solve everyday problems through the application of knowledge acquired from experience.
Analytical Intelligence
Part of Sternberg’s Triarchic Theory of Intelligence, focusing on the ability to analyze, evaluate, judge, compare, and contrast.
Creative Intelligence
The aspect of intelligence that involves the capacity to be flexible, innovative, and inventive in thinking.
